Kolarov puts Serbia on the verge of World Cup qualification

Kolarov puts Serbia on the verge of World Cup qualification Source: Reuters

Aleksandar Kolarov's second half strike gets Serbia deserved victory against Republic of Ireland 1-0. The win puts Serbia four points clear at the top of the group with two games to play - away at Austria and home to Georgia (6 and 10 October). 

Serbia went into the game with an unbeaten record and had the better early chances before took the lead on 55 minutes, when Kolarov hammered a shot in off the bar to silence the home crowd.

Serbian team had to play the last 22 minutes with 10 men after Nikola Maksimovic was sent off.

In the Asian zone qualifiers, Australia will face Syria in a play-off to stay in race for a World Cup, after both teams missed the chance to seal automatic qualification on Tuesday. After defeating Thailand 2-1, Socceroos needed a massive favour from Japan, who last night played Saudi Arabia. But, Japan failed to secure a point in Jeddah, as Saudi substitute Fahad Al-Muwallad scored for 1-0 victory.

Australia now faces two difficult ties against war-torn Syria in October to book a decisive games versus North and Central America's fourth-placed team in November for a spot at the 2018 World Cup.
